Mare of Easttown (2021)

Description: 'Mare of Easttown' and 'The Night Of' both focus on a crime investigation that deeply affects a small community. Both series feature a flawed, complex protagonist and a narrative that explores the personal and professional challenges of solving the case.

Fact: Starring Kate Winslet in the titular role. The series was praised for its authentic portrayal of a small Pennsylvania town. The mystery kept viewers guessing until the final episodes.

The Killing (2011)

Description: 'The Killing' shares with 'The Night Of' a focus on a single crime and its far-reaching consequences. Both series are character-driven, with a strong emphasis on the emotional and psychological impact of the investigation on those involved.

Fact: Originally based on the Danish series 'Forbrydelsen'. The show was known for its 'red herrings' and unpredictable plot twists. Mireille Enos and Joel Kinnaman star as the lead detectives.

Broadchurch (2013)

Description: 'Broadchurch' shares with 'The Night Of' a focus on a small community rocked by a crime, exploring the ripple effects on the town's residents. Both series emphasize character development and the emotional toll of the investigation, with a meticulous attention to detail in the storytelling.

Fact: David Tennant and Olivia Colman star as the lead detectives. The show was filmed in Dorset, England, and the location plays a significant role in the series. The identity of the killer was kept secret from the cast until the final episodes were filmed.

True Detective (2014)

Description: Similar to 'The Night Of', 'True Detective' is a crime drama that delves deep into the psychological and moral complexities of its characters. Both series feature a slow-burning narrative that focuses on the investigation process and the impact of crime on individuals and communities. The dark, atmospheric tone and intricate storytelling are key similarities.

Fact: The first season of 'True Detective' was written entirely by Nic Pizzolatto. Matthew McConaughey and Woody Harrelson's performances were critically acclaimed. The series is known for its philosophical undertones and references to weird fiction.

Sharp Objects (2018)

Description: 'Sharp Objects' and 'The Night Of' both delve into the dark underbelly of their settings, with a focus on the psychological trauma of their protagonists. Both series use a slow, deliberate pace to build tension and explore the complexities of their characters' pasts.

Fact: Based on the novel by Gillian Flynn, who also wrote 'Gone Girl'. Amy Adams stars as the troubled journalist Camille Preaker. The series features a haunting soundtrack and atmospheric cinematography.

Big Little Lies (2017)

Description: 'Big Little Lies' and 'The Night Of' both explore the consequences of a crime within a tight-knit community, with a focus on the personal lives and secrets of the characters involved. Both series blend drama and mystery, with a strong emphasis on character development.

Fact: Based on the novel by Liane Moriarty. Features an all-star cast including Reese Witherspoon, Nicole Kidman, and Shailene Woodley. The series won multiple Emmy Awards, including Outstanding Limited Series.

The Undoing (2020)

Description: Like 'The Night Of', 'The Undoing' is a psychological thriller that explores themes of guilt, innocence, and the unpredictability of human behavior. Both series feature a high-profile cast and a narrative that keeps viewers guessing until the end.

Fact: Starring Nicole Kidman and Hugh Grant. Based on the novel 'You Should Have Known' by Jean Hanff Korelitz. The series was filmed in New York City, adding to its glamorous yet sinister atmosphere.

The Outsider (2020)

Description: 'The Outsider' shares with 'The Night Of' a dark, suspenseful tone and a focus on a crime that defies easy explanation. Both series explore the psychological and supernatural elements of their stories, with a strong emphasis on atmosphere and tension.

Fact: Based on the novel by Stephen King. Ben Mendelsohn stars as the lead detective. The series blends crime drama with supernatural horror.

The Night Manager (2016)

Description: 'The Night Manager' shares with 'The Night Of' a tense, atmospheric narrative and a focus on a protagonist drawn into a dangerous world. Both series feature high-stakes drama and a meticulous attention to detail in their storytelling.

Fact: Based on the novel by John le Carré. Starring Tom Hiddleston and Hugh Laurie. The series was filmed in multiple international locations, adding to its global intrigue.

The Sinner (2017)

Description: Like 'The Night Of', 'The Sinner' is a crime drama that explores the psychological underpinnings of a crime, focusing on why it happened rather than who did it. Both series feature a protagonist who is deeply affected by the case, and both use a nonlinear narrative to unravel the mystery.

Fact: The first season is based on the novel by Petra Hammesfahr. Bill Pullman stars as Detective Harry Ambrose. Each season explores a different crime and set of characters, with a common thematic thread.
